When playing a long career game where i only want to manage one club, do i set all leagues to playable or view only, and does it make a difference to the ammount of newgens coming through on a large data base and as many leagues as possible..:)

With "View only" nations, you'll find that only the top clubs have a full squad of newgens - whereas the smaller clubs in the same league will have only a handful, if any at all.

Having the league as "Playable" will ensure a full compliment of players.

Obviously you can't load up every league, so it's up to you to pick and choose the nations that are important to you.

For myself:

Playable

- England

- France

- Germany

- Italy

- Holland (top division only)

- Portugal (top division only)

- Russia (top division only)

- Scotland

- Spain

- Argentina (top division only)

- Brazil (top division only)

View Only

- Belgium

- Turkey

- Ukraine

- Serbia

Also helps to retain players from certain nations - USA? Australia? African countries? Places that won't be covered by any leagues perhaps.

Having said all this, FM12 might well be played very differently - as you can add and drop leagues as your season progresses. Check out the sticky threads for more reading on that.
